ByCommute: from shipping containers to bike shelters

ByCommute was founded in April 2022 by two student entrepreneurs from Grenoble, including an engineering student from Phelma. The startup buys shipping containers that no longer meet regulatory standards and transforms them into bespoke bike boxes.
Each product is fully customizable according to the customer’s desires and budget. The first step is to determine the dimensions of the box and the number of stands, before choosing other features to include, like electric bike charging points, surveillance cameras, planted roofs, locking systems (RFID, connected locks), and more.
The boxes are transformed in Pontcharra, near Grenoble, using mostly French-made components (the rest are of European origin). A customized box has already been installed at the UGA campus in Valence. Demand is growing steadily, with several new projects already on the order books.
